Output ecfc4798f08d1744038c0bafdf26774d1a6034717f49ab43fff35180c36258ea:0

value
150000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 618839cbc55efc6a220f53d7199d32ac7566c711 OP_EQUALVERIFY OP_CHECKSIG
address
19thjjuGebnLW4usB6dsSBFiKoHDQZLBGE
transaction
ecfc4798f08d1744038c0bafdf26774d1a6034717f49ab43fff35180c36258ea
spent
true